The Honeywell 2MLK-CPUS-CC Processor Module is a high-performance central processor designed for safety and control applications in industrial automation systems. Its compact and robust design allows coordination of multiple I/O modules, execution of complex control algorithms, and continuous monitoring of critical process parameters. With built-in diagnostics and electrical isolation, this processor module ensures reliable 24/7 operation, making it ideal for safety instrumented systems and demanding industrial environments.

Typical Application Scenarios
Centralized processing of safety and control logic in industrial automation systems
Integration with Honeywell safety instrumented systems (SIS) for chemical, petrochemical, and pharmaceutical plants
Coordination of multiple input/output modules for real-time process monitoring
Execution of complex control algorithms in power generation and manufacturing facilities
Supervisory control of critical safety and operational functions
Continuous monitoring and management of process parameters such as temperature, pressure, flow, and level
Core Performance Benefits
High-performance processor for reliable execution of safety and control logic
Compact and lightweight design for flexible installation in control racks
Supports multiple I/O modules for coordinated process control
Built-in diagnostics for early detection of faults and system health monitoring
Electrical isolation for protection and signal integrity
Robust industrial-grade construction for continuous 24/7 operation
